You are invited to a Health Coalition Design Day Conference

WHO

This event is free and open to individuals and organizations working to advance health in Dunn County. This includes direct health providers and others concerned with social determinants of health who want to support a healthier community and advance health equity in Dunn County.

WHY

Coalitions are created by organizations and individuals who believe that we can only create the change we need together. We want to:

  • Maximize the power of individuals and groups through collective action
  • Build strength by connecting individuals and organizations
  • Improve trust and communication between agencies and organizations
  • Increase community participation and leadership
  • Mobilize diverse talents, resources, and strategies
  • Share costs and associated risks; share power and reduce conflict
